Quilting books
I may not have any of my supplies yet, but thanks to my dad I have some beautiful quiling books already I have:
Quilted Memories Celebrations of Life by Mary Lou Weidman. It's a beautiful book, but more just to look at then anything.
Colorwash Bargello Quilts by Beth Ann Williams.
40 Bright & Bold Paper-Pieced Blocks by Carol Doak. These are some goregous blocks.
Grandma's Best Full Size Quilt Blocks. This is a Better Homes and Gardens books with 101 blocks and more than 5,000 quilting combinations. I really like this book.
The Handbook of Quilting. Has decriptions for all types of quilting.
The simple Joys of Quilting 30 Timeless Quilt Projects by Joan Hanson and Mary Hickey. This one has lots of tips and is easy to understand, probablly my favorite so far.
Now I just need to get the ones the rest of you have recommended and my supplies and I'll be all set.
